Checkpointing
Capture durable session context without growing the always-loaded root
CLAUDE.md. Canonical state and artifacts live under .claude/.
Owned Paths
.claude/checkpoints/: full timestamped checkpoints; never deleted by the compact phase..claude/checkpoints/INDEX.md: generated catalog of every checkpoint.PROGRESS.md: latest five checkpoint summaries..claude/STATE.md: one Progress Tracker link and current working blocks..claude/logs/: drafts, previews, work logs, and CLI activity..claude/docs/research/: research notes; inactive notes may be archived only after user approval.
Both scripts write nothing without --apply. Every default run produces preview
files under .claude/logs/ and leaves PROGRESS.md and .claude/STATE.md
untouched.
Full Checkpoint
-
Determine the time window from the newest checkpoint, or use all available history when none exists.
-
Gather the user requests and decisions from the current conversation, git changes, CLI logs, team work logs, and relevant design changes.
-
Write a Japanese five-part summary containing:
何をしたのか,どういうやり取りをユーザーと行ったのか,どうやったのか,途中でどういう課題が起こったのか, and将来のアクション. This is the irreducible judgment in the skill and is never generated: a missing, empty, stale, or incomplete summary aborts the run with exit2. -
Save the summary to
.claude/logs/pending-summary.md, then preview:python3 .claude/skills/checkpointing/checkpoint.py \ --summary-file .claude/logs/pending-summary.mdExit
0reportsresult: previewand four preview files (checkpoint-preview-*,index-preview-*,progress-preview-*,state-preview-*under.claude/logs/). Exit1is a bad--since/--now; exit2is a summary or shared-state contract violation; exit3is a timestamp collision, a concurrent modification, or a write failure.Add
--label <slug>when the session's commit messages would not name it well; the label becomes the checkpoint's slug in the frontmatter and the index. -
Review the four previews, then write for real:
